Fortrea's First Quarter Highlights: Revenue and Leadership Changes

Financial Performance Overview
For the first three months of the year, Fortrea (Nasdaq: FTRE) demonstrated a strong commitment to its strategic objectives, despite facing challenges. The company reported revenues totaling $651.3 million. Although this reflects a slight decline from the $662.1 million reported in the same period last year, it showcases Fortrea's ongoing efforts to streamline operations.
Loss and Adjustments
In this quarter, the organization experienced a GAAP net loss of $(562.9) million, primarily due to a non-cash goodwill impairment charge of $488.8 million. This dramatic entry influenced the diluted loss per share, which stood at $(6.25). On a more positive note, Fortrea's adjusted EBITDA was reported at $30.3 million, surpassing the previous year’s adjusted EBITDA of $27.1 million.
Key Financial Metrics
The quarter's backlog reached an impressive $7.721 billion, reflecting a book-to-bill ratio of 1.02x. This statistic indicates that for every dollar earned, the company secured $1.02 in new orders. Additionally, looking over the trailing twelve months, Fortrea achieved a book-to-bill ratio of 1.14x. This trend showcases the organization’s ability to grow despite fluctuations in revenue.
Guidance for the Year Ahead
Looking forward, Fortrea maintains its revenue guidance for the full year, targeting figures between $2.45 billion and $2.55 billion. The adjusted EBITDA guidance aligns with this optimism, estimating figures in the range of $170 million to $200 million. This guidance presumes stability in foreign currency exchange rates, akin to those on December 31, 2024.
Leadership Transitions
Amid these financial updates, Fortrea announced significant leadership changes. Peter M. Neupert, the Lead Independent Director, has been appointed as the Interim Chief Executive Officer and Board Chair, following the news of Thomas Pike stepping down. Neupert’s experience is expected to bring stability during this transitional phase.
Looking to the Future
The leadership transition aims to enhance Fortrea’s operational effectiveness while ensuring continuity in strategic initiatives. As part of this transition, Pike will provide consulting support to assist the new leadership in navigating this pivotal moment for the company.
